Stand to Be Named After Mithali Raj at ACA-VDCA Stadium in Visakhapatnam
The Andhra Cricket Association (ACA) has announced that two sections of the ACA-VDCA Stadium in Visakhapatnam will be dedicated to iconic Indian women cricketers Mithali Raj and Ravi Kalpana on October 12, ahead of the India vs Australia ICC Women’s World Cup 2025 fixture.
Honouring Women’s Cricket Legends
As part of its ongoing efforts to celebrate women’s contributions to cricket, the ACA will name a stand after Mithali Raj and a gate after Ravi Kalpana. This marks a landmark moment for women’s cricket in Andhra Pradesh and across India.
“The ACA’s tribute to Mithali Raj and Ravi Kalpana reflects a deep commitment to honouring the trailblazers who have redefined women’s cricket in India while inspiring the next generation to dream bigger,” the ACA said in a statement.
Mithali Raj: A Trailblazer
Mithali Raj, former captain of the Indian women’s cricket team, represented India 333 times across formats and is one of the most accomplished batters in the history of women’s cricket. Her remarkable career has inspired generations of cricketers to aim higher and dream bigger.
Ravi Kalpana: Inspiring Journey
Ravi Kalpana, an Andhra-born wicketkeeper-batter, made her mark from the state circuit to the national team. Her journey has motivated countless young cricketers in the region and exemplifies the growing strength of women’s cricket in India.
Match Context
The stand and gate dedication coincides with the India vs Australia Women’s World Cup 2025 match at ACA-VDCA Stadium in Visakhapatnam, adding a historic backdrop to the ongoing tournament.
